The OST lineup for the second season of Celebrating Years had already been announced. Among them, Li Jian sang the theme song " In My Lifetime," Zhou Shen sang the ending song " Excuse me," Liang Long, Liu Duanduan, Zhang Haowei, and Guo Zifan performed the promotional song " Aiya." These songs would bring more musical elements to the second season of " Celebrating Years," adding more emotions and atmosphere to the plot.

OST was the shortened form of original music, which referred to the music used in movies, TV series, games, and other media works. It included scores or songs from movies, as well as music from anime. OST was usually released in the form of an album for the audience to enjoy. It could be released as an independent piece of music and receive independent attention and recognition.
The OST of " Praying for Today " included a theme song called " Miracle." This song was sung by the JS group. They had once sung "Kill the Wolf" for the Legend of the Sword and Fairy. According to the comments of the netizens, this song displayed a pure Xianxia flavor as soon as it opened. In addition to the JS group, Zhou Shen, Shan Yichun, Yu Jiayun, and other singers also participated in the OST of this drama.
